#63e304 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#63e304 is composed of 38.8% red, 89%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 98.2%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 94.4 degrees, a saturation of 96.5% and a lightness of 45.3%. #63e304 color hex could be obtained by blending #c6ff08 with #00c700. Closest websafe color is: #66cc00.

#63e304 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#63e304 has RGB values of R:99, G:227,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0.56, M:0, Y:0.98,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 6546180.

Shades and Tints of #63e304
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070f00 is the darkest color, while #fcfffb is the lightest one.
